Full review

Renting at $1,050 per month, this 920 sqft apartment is one of the more accessible options in Jefferson City. While the price is appealing, the lack of amenities may limit its attractiveness to some. Notably, there are no laundry facilities or designated parking, which could be inconvenient for residents.

The property has been on the market for just 14 days, indicating that demand may be moderate. Prospective renters should consider other nearby options, as similar properties might offer additional conveniences for a slightly higher rent.

For those with pets, this listing is not pet-friendly, which could narrow its appeal further. if you're looking for vibrant community features, the neighborhood may feel quiet and lacking in entertainment options compared to more urban areas.
